Transaction 89f8d73de894133cec9d860a2607c28809b5a707d16bc931a27345bf74ab99d1
1 Input
1 Output
-
89f8d73de894133cec9d860a2607c28809b5a707d16bc931a27345bf74ab99d1:0
- value
- 509115
- script pubkey
- OP_0 OP_PUSHBYTES_20 166b2b85dac4f6736228ab8f2644c989c0804463
- address
- bc1qze4jhpw6cnm8xc3g4w8jv3xf38qgq3rr82qmye